%@ page import = "java.util.*"%>
Timezone Checker
Timezone and Daylight Savings Time
<%=new java.util.Date().toString()%>
<%System.out.println( new java.util.Date().toString() );%>
<%TimeZone tz = TimeZone.getDefault();
System.out.println( tz ); %>
<%out.println( tz.getID() ) ;
System.out.println( tz.getID() ) ;%>
<%out.println( tz.getDisplayName() ) ;
System.out.println( tz.getDisplayName() ) ; %>
<%out.println( "Curently " + ( tz.inDaylightTime( new Date() ) ? "in " : "not in " ) + "daylight-savings time." ) ;
System.out.println( "Curently " + ( tz.inDaylightTime( new Date() ) ? "in " : "not in " ) + "daylight-savings time." ) ;
// End of First Display, current time and TimeZone
%>
<% Date today = new Date();
// Get all time zone ids
String[] zoneIds = TimeZone.getAvailableIDs();
// View every time zone
// Create a table for displaying the timezone information
out.println("Timezone Information:
");
out.println("");
out.println("" + "ID" + " | " + "Short Name" + " | " + "Long Name" + " | " + "Hour Offset" + " | " + "Minute Offset" + " | " + "Has Daylight Savings?" + " | " + "In Daylight Savings?" + " |
");
for (int i=0; i" + zoneIds[i] + " | " + shortName + " | " + longName + " | " + hour + " | " + min + " | " + hasDST + " | "+ inDST + " | ");
// End of table
}
%>